Output df8c4f3d013e6085337519cfd4a6b1ca1a7534019f6503724a66b2d864bb20a4:2

value
184756
script pubkey
OP_0 OP_PUSHBYTES_20 ae06ae2409bfc27141722d898bea8a1c6a490f15
address
tb1q4cr2ufqfhlp8zstj9kych652r34yjrc4q6xhk6
transaction
df8c4f3d013e6085337519cfd4a6b1ca1a7534019f6503724a66b2d864bb20a4
confirmations
43637
spent
true